Adaptive Vs Maladaptive Coping Strategies Maladaptive coping strategies refer to ineffective cognitive and behavioral efforts employed by individuals to manage stressors, which not only fail to alleviate immediate stress but also hinder the ability to adapt to similar stressors in the future. Maladaptive coping mechanisms are counterproductive behaviors people use to manage stress, emotional pain, or difficult situations. they provide short term relief but create bigger problems over time. common examples include avoidance, substance use, self blame, emotional suppression, and social withdrawal.
